Government run lotteries may have higher payouts and odds.
A few examples are:

7 numbers / 47 balls lottery with odds of 1 in 20,963,833
6 numbers / 49 balls lottery 1 in 13,983,816
6 numbers / 45 balls lottery 1 in 4,072,530.5

Charitable Lotteries usually have better odds.
Single Tickets may range from $5 to $100+
A few examples are:
Princess Margaret Hospital Foundation Home Lottery
had 1 in 345,000 odds to win the top prize for 2007
London Dream Lottery
had 1 in 124,000 odds to win the top prize for 2007
Rotary Dream Home of Guelph

had 1 in 7,500 odds to win the top prize for 2007
